Sounds like its either the Ignition Starter Switch or the Starter itself. Check the wiring on the start... make sure all the nuts are tight. Might even wanna clean them up and see if that makes a difference. You could try jumping the connection yourself (MAKE SURE THE CAR IS OUT OF GEAR), although its been a while since I've looked at our starter... not sure if that's even a possibility these days.
